How to Pair PS4 Controller with PC: Step-by-Step Guide
Pairing your PS4 controller with your PC involves a straightforward process, especially with Bluetooth functionality. The following steps detail the PS4 controller pairing method.
Step-by-Step Bluetooth Setup for PS4 Controller
1. Ensure your PS4 controller is charged. A full battery helps prevent connectivity issues during setup.
2. On your PC, go to the Bluetooth settings by typing 'Bluetooth' in the Start menu search and selecting 'Bluetooth and other devices'. Ensure Bluetooth is enabled.
3. On your PS4 controller, press and hold the Share button and the PS button simultaneously until the light bar starts flashing. This indicates the controller is in pairing mode.
4. Back on your PC, select 'Add Bluetooth or other device', choose Bluetooth, and wait for your PS4 controller to appear in the list.
5. Select the controller name to initiate the pairing process. Once connected, the light bar should change color, indicating a successful connection.
Troubleshooting Bluetooth Controller Issues
If you encounter issues during the pairing process, first ensure that no other devices are interfering with the connection. Disconnect any other Bluetooth devices and repeat the procedure. If the controller still doesn’t connect, consider updating your Bluetooth drivers.

Using DS4Windows for PS4 Controller Optimization
DS4Windows is a popular software that allows you to use your PS4 controller on PC with enhanced settings. This software enables advanced features such as button remapping, sensitivity tweaks, and profile management for different games.

Identify Problems with PS4 Controller Recognition
Sometimes the PC may fail to recognize your controller. In such cases, ensure that your controller is in pairing mode. If recognition issues persist, reinstalling corresponding drivers may be necessary. Check your Device Manager for driver-related problems.
Fix PS4 Controller Lag on PC
Latency can affect gameplay significantly. Ensure that your Bluetooth drivers are current and that the signal between the controller and the PC is unobstructed. A poor connection or interference can lead to lag, disrupting your gaming flow.

Q&A Section: Common Questions About Connecting a PS4 Controller to PC
What to do if my PS4 controller won’t connect to PC?
If your PS4 controller isn’t connecting, make sure it’s charged and in pairing mode. Restart your PC's Bluetooth service and try reconnecting.
Can I use PS4 controller with non-Steam games?
Yes, you can use your PS4 controller with non-Steam games as long as they're configured correctly with applicable software, such as DS4Windows.
How do I disconnect the PS4 controller from my PC?
To disconnect your controller, go to Bluetooth settings, select your controller from the list, and click ‘Remove device’ or ‘Disconnect’.
